Rubric “Roads of Georgia” – Development of international corridors

The country’s main priority is developing international corridors, with active work underway in three directions: east-west, north-south and the Kakheti highway.
In the morning show of Imedi TV’s Rubric “Roads of Georgia,” Giorgi Tsereteli, the chairman of the highways department, discussed the measures taken to ensure safe travel, the budget allocated for these roads, and the current progress of the ongoing projects.
